The Archdiocese of Seattle is seeking an Executive Assistant to the Auxiliary Bishop in Tacoma, WA. This full-time, on-site role provides administrative support, drafts correspondence, manages calendars, and coordinates travel and events.
BA preferred; 4–5 years of high-level secretarial experience; strong MS Office skills required; annual compensation aligns with hourly range of 35.50–38.00 USD.

The Archbishop is the visible principle and foundation of unity in the particular Church entrusted to him. In a unique and visible way, he makes Christ’s mission present and enduring as Shepherd of the Christian Community. In order to fulfill his mission, the Archbishop employs suitable, chosen collaborators (clerics, religious, or lay people). He shares with them the apostolic mission and entrusts various responsibilities to them. (Directory on the Pastoral Ministry of Bishops, 198)
Each position employed in the Chancery helps to extend the ministry of the Archbishop in particular ways as outlined in the position description.
